Output 4576742ebe12bf20315facd688743fb272db1cb2c6faa8839cd1a5b8829bf20b:0

value
1609500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f957667f878248887ee58df80f3d86fd2cdd0f OP_EQUAL
address
33y4qh7XutfH3YSFx31LJNaJcpVLL23Jt6
transaction
4576742ebe12bf20315facd688743fb272db1cb2c6faa8839cd1a5b8829bf20b
spent
true